Share via


HP Service Manager Integration Pack per System Center - Orchestrator

Importante

Questa versione di Orchestrator ha raggiunto la fine del supporto. È consigliabile eseguire l'aggiornamento a Orchestrator 2022.

Il Integration Pack per HP Service Manager è un componente aggiuntivo per Orchestrator in System Center e System Center - Orchestrator che consente di recuperare, creare, aggiornare e monitorare i ticket in HP Service Manager.

Microsoft si impegna a proteggere la privacy offrendo software che offre prestazioni, potenza e praticità desiderate. Per altre informazioni, vedere l'informativa sulla privacy di System Center Orchestrator.

Requisiti di sistema

Integration Pack per HP Service Manager richiede l'installazione e la configurazione del seguente software per l'implementazione dell'integrazione. Per altre informazioni sull'installazione e la configurazione di Orchestrator e del servizio Web HP Service Manager, vedere la relativa documentazione del prodotto.

  • Per gli Integration Pack di System Center 2016 è necessario System Center 2016 - Orchestrator
  • Per gli Integration Pack di System Center 2019 è necessario System Center 2019 - Orchestrator
  • HP Service Manager 7.11 o 9

È necessario installare il seguente software su ciascun Runbook Server e Runbook Designer:

  • Microsoft .NET Framework 3.5 Service Pack 1
  • Driver Microsoft SQL Server Native Client ODBC (installato con gli strumenti di gestione di SQL Server)
  • Per accedere al database di HP Service Manager database su SQL Server:
    • Driver Microsoft SQL Server Native Client ODBC (installato con gli strumenti di gestione di SQL Server)
  • Per accedere al database di HP Service Manager su Oracle:
    • Client Oracle (Assistente alla configurazione di rete)
    • Driver ODBC Oracle

È in corso il download dell'Integration Pack

Registrazione e distribuzione dell'Integration Pack

Dopo aver scaricato il file di Integration Pack, registrarlo con il server di gestione di Orchestrator e distribuirlo ai server runbook e a Runbook Designer. Per le procedure per l'installazione di Integration Pack, vedere Come aggiungere un Integration Pack.

Preparazione alla connessione al server di HP Service Manager

  • Creare un record contenente il nome e il numero della porta del server di HP Service Manager utilizzati per la connessione al client di HP Service Manager.
  • Per tutti i server di HP Service Manager a cui collegarsi, creare un nome origine dati ODBC (DSN, Data Source Name) su ciascun client e server Runbook. Sono supportate le connessioni native di SQL Server e di Oracle ODBC. Vedere Configurazione dell'Service Manager Connections HP.
  • Il modello di licenze dei componenti di HP Service Manager varia a seconda della versione installata. Consultare la documentazione di prodotto HP per stabilire quali componenti vengono concessi in licenza separatamente. Per funzionare correttamente, l'integration pack richiede l'accesso al servizio Web SOAP di HP Service Manager. Verificare che il componente sia installato e concesso in licenza, se necessario.
  • Verificare che all'utente configurato per l'accesso al server di HP Service Manager sia stato assegnato SOAP-API CAPABILITY WORD nel sistema di HP Service Manager. A seconda della versione di HP Service Manager, potrebbe essere necessario acquistare licenze aggiuntive per abilitare SOAP-API CAPABILITY WORD. Per altre informazioni sulle licenze, consultare hp Sales Representative.

Configurazione delle connessioni di HP Service Manager

Una connessione stabilisce un collegamento riutilizzabile tra Orchestrator e un server HP Service Manager. È possibile creare tutte le connessioni necessarie, specificando collegamenti a più server che eseguono HP Service Manager. È possibile anche creare più connessioni verso lo stesso server in modo da differenziare le autorizzazioni di protezione dei diversi account utente.

L'integration pack di HP Service Manager richiede una connessione al database SQL Server di HP Service Manager per progettare i Runbook in Runbook Designer. Prima di configurare la connessione di HP Service Manager in Runbook Designer, configurare una connessione ODBC valida.

Per evitare possibili danneggiamenti, non usare mezzi alternativi per connettersi direttamente al database. Usare sempre la connessione ODBC per garantire l'integrazione appropriata.

Per configurare una connessione ODBC di SQL Server

  1. Aprire l'utilità amministratore origine dati ODBC (32 bit). Per accedere a questa utilità, selezionare Start, Esegui e quindi immettere \Windows\SysWOW64\odbcad32.exe nella casella Apri . Selezionare OK.
  2. Nell'amministratore origine dati ODBC selezionare la scheda DSN di sistema.
  3. Selezionare Aggiungi.
  4. Selezionare il driver denominato SQL Server Native Client 10.0 dall'elenco dei driver disponibili.
  5. Selezionare Fine.
  6. Immettere un nuovo nome e descrizione per l'origine dati.
  7. Immettere il nome o l'indirizzo IP del server database di HP Service Manager nella casella Server.
  8. Selezionare Avanti.
  9. Selezionare il metodo di autenticazione adeguato per il server di database, quindi immettere credenziali valide.
  10. Selezionare Avanti.
  11. Verificare che la casella di controllo Modifica il database predefinito in: è selezionata.
  12. Nell'elenco a discesa sotto la casella di controllo selezionare il database HP Service Manager.
  13. Selezionare Avanti.
  14. Selezionare Fine.
  15. Selezionare Test origine dati per confermare la connettività al database.
  16. Al termine del test, selezionare OK.
  17. Selezionare OK.

Impostazione di una connessione Oracle ODBC

  1. Configurare un nome di Oracle Net Service usando Oracle Net Configuration Assistant. Per altre informazioni su questo passaggio, vedere la documentazione del prodotto Oracle pertinente.
  2. Aprire l'utility di amministrazione dell'origine dati ODBC (32 bit). Per accedere a questa utilità, selezionare Avvia, quindi Esegui e quindi immettere \Windows\SysWOW64\odbcad32.exe nella casella Apri . Selezionare OK.
  3. Nell'amministratore origine dati ODBC selezionare la scheda DSN di sistema .
  4. Selezionare Aggiungi.
  5. Dall'elenco dei driver disponibili, selezionare il driver Oracle ODBC installato con il client Oracle.
  6. Selezionare Fine.
  7. Immettere un nuovo nome e descrizione per l'origine dati.
  8. Immettere il nome del servizio TNS del database di HP Service Manager come è stato configurato in Net Configuration Assistant.
  9. Verificare la connessione fornendo le credenziali, se necessario.
  10. Selezionare il metodo di autenticazione adeguato per il server di database, quindi immettere credenziali valide.
  11. Selezionare OK.
  12. Selezionare OK per chiudere l'amministratore origine dati ODBC.

Per configurare una connessione HP Service Manager

  1. Nel runbook Designer selezionare il menu Opzioni e selezionare HP Service Manager. Viene visualizzata la finestra di dialogo HP Service Manager.
  2. Nella scheda Connections selezionare Aggiungi per avviare la configurazione della connessione. Verrà visualizzata la finestra di dialogo Configurazione connessione .
  3. Nella casella Nome immettere un nome per la connessione. Per distinguere il tipo di connessione è possibile utilizzare il nome del server di HP Service Manager o un nome descrittivo.
  4. Nella casella Indirizzo server immettere il nome o l'indirizzo IP del computer HP Service Manager. Se si usa il nome del computer, è possibile immettere il nome NetBIOS o il nome di dominio completo (FQDN).
  5. Nella casella Intervallo di polling immettere la frequenza, in minuti, per controllare lo stato della connessione hp Service Manager.
  6. Nella casella DSN ODBC immettere il nome dell'origine dati ODBC da una delle procedure precedenti.
  7. Immettere il nome utente del database nella casella Nome utente DB.
  8. Immettere la password del database nella casella Password DB.
  9. Nelle caselle Nome utente e password immettere le credenziali usate da Orchestrator per connettersi al server HP Service Manager.
  10. Selezionare Test connessione. Quando viene visualizzato il messaggio "Connessa correttamente", selezionare OK.
  11. Nella finestra di dialogo elenco connessioni selezionare la connessione appena creata selezionando l'elemento appropriato nell'elenco.
  12. Selezionare il pulsante Aggiorna cache campo per recuperare e archiviare la configurazione personalizzata dal server HP Service Manager. Il completamento dell'operazione potrebbe richiedere alcuni minuti ed è fondamentale per connettere l'integration pack con un nuovo server di HP Service Manager.
  13. Aggiungere ulteriori connessioni ad altri server di HP Service Manager, se applicabile.
  14. Selezionare OK per chiudere la finestra di dialogo di configurazione e selezionare Fine.

Suggerimento

Per il database DB Username and DB Password - Se il database HPSM si trova in un computer che esegue Windows Server e si configura IL DSN ODBC con autenticazione di Windows, è possibile immettere qualsiasi elemento per il nome utente e la password perché i campi non devono essere vuoti in modo che il pulsante Test connessione funzioni. Se si usa SQL Server autenticazione, è necessario disporre del nome utente e della password per il database hpSM SQL Server. L'utente deve avere accesso in lettura/scrittura al database tramite la connessione DSN.

Esporre i campi richiesti

Se un'attività segnala un errore e indica che è necessario specificare un campo obbligatorio, ma l'INDIRIZZO IP non fornisce il campo nell'interfaccia utente, il campo deve essere esposto tramite l'API del servizio Web HP Service Manager. Per esporre il campo, completare la procedura seguente:

Per rivelare un campo obbligatorio

  1. Aprire il client di HP Service Manager.
  2. Connettersi al server desiderato di HP Service Manager.
  3. In Esplora sistema passare a Strumenti di personalizzazione, quindi Servizi Web, quindi Configurazione WSDL e fare doppio clic sull'opzione Configurazione WSDL .
  4. Nella finestra di dialogo Definizione accesso esterno selezionare il pulsante Cerca per elencare tutti gli oggetti disponibili.
  5. Selezionare l'oggetto richiesto dall'elenco.
  6. Selezionare la scheda Fields.
  7. Scorrere fino alla fine di Field List.
  8. Immettere il nome del database del campo da esporre nella colonna Field.
  9. Immettere il nome del servizio Web che farà riferimento a questo campo nella colonna Caption.
  10. Verificare la correttezza del tipo di dati nella colonna Type.
  11. Selezionare Salva nella parte superiore della pagina per salvare il messaggio.

Problemi noti

  • Il pulsante Test connessione non può essere usato per convalidare Service Manager connessioni al servizio Web 7.1 se il servizio Web HP ServiceCenter 6.2 è stato disabilitato.

  • Sono richieste alcune autorizzazioni per lavorare con i ticket di modifica. Queste autorizzazioni vengono specificate tramite l'assegnazione a un utente di un profilo di gestione modifiche. Anche se un utente può avere più di un profilo, esso può appartenere a un solo profilo per ciascuna sessione. Se l'utente viene assegnato più di un profilo di gestione modifiche, userà automaticamente il primo profilo nell'ordine alfabetico. Per evitare confusione, è consigliabile che l'utente configurato per l'uso con il Integration Pack sia assegnato solo un profilo di gestione modifiche.

  • L'utente configurato per l'utilizzo dell'integration pack deve aver impostato le preferenze del fuso orario su GMT/Universale, usando un formato di data di gg/mm/aa.

  • In alcune versioni di HP Service Manager, l'elenco delle categorie disponibili durante la creazione di un evento imprevisto visualizza Modifica, ma la scelta causa l'esito negativo dell'oggetto con il messaggio seguente: specificare una categoria valida. Si tratta di un problema noto del server di HP Service Manager. Assicurarsi che i campi siano visibili al servizio Web (vedere Risoluzione dei problemi) e il server HP Service Manager sia sottoposto a patch alla versione più recente.

  • Il pulsante Imposta come predefinito disponibile nelle attività Crea voce, Aggiorna voce e Chiudi voce può segnalare un errore quando selezionato. Per aggirare il problema, attenersi alla procedura riportata di seguito.

    1. Annotare il percorso del file presente nel messaggio di errore. Ad esempio, C:\Users\[CurrentUser]\AppData\Local\Microsoft\System Center 2012\Orchestrator\IntegrationPacks\HPServiceManager\[GUID]\defaultFields.xml
    2. Verificare che ciascuna cartella nel percorso del file sia esistente proprio come indicato nel messaggio di errore.
    3. Se necessario, creare le cartelle mancanti.

    se Runbook Designer viene avviato da un utente privo di privilegi amministrativi sul computer. Nella versione corrente del Integration Pack assicurarsi che l'utente disponga di autorizzazioni sufficienti per scrivere nella directory %COMMONPROGRAMFILES(x86)%\Microsoft System Center 2012\Orchestrator\Extensions\Support\HPServiceManager.